What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Holbrook?
The Town of Holbrook Building Department enforces the 2021 IRC with 10th Edition Massachusetts amendments, requiring specific ice and water shield applications. Contractors must hold Massachusetts Construction Supervisor Licenses through the Office of Consumer Affairs. Current code mandates 36-inch ice and water shield coverage from eaves, sealed decking at valleys, and step flashing integration with wall systems. These requirements address common failure points in New England's freeze-thaw cycles and wind-driven rain conditions.

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ional asphalt when replacing my roof?
Solar shingles integrate well with SMART Program incentives and the 30% federal tax credit, but require careful evaluation. Traditional architectural asphalt offers better impact resistance for Holbrook's hail risk and costs 40-60% less upfront. Solar shingles provide energy generation but have lower wind ratings and require specialized installation. Consider your energy consumption patterns, remaining roof life expectancy, and whether separate solar panels on a new asphalt roof might offer better value.

My roof looks fine from the ground - why would I need a professional inspection?
Traditional visual inspections miss sub-surface moisture trapped within architectural asphalt shingle layers and pine plank decking. Infrared thermography identifies temperature variations indicating wet insulation or rotting wood before visible damage appears. Drone-based aerial mapping provides millimeter-accurate measurements of shingle deterioration and flashing gaps. These technologies reveal problems 12-18 months before leaks develop, allowing proactive repairs that prevent structural damage.
What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Holbrook's severe weather?
Holbrook's 115 mph wind zone requires Class 4 impact-rated shingles with enhanced attachment systems. These shingles withstand 2-inch hail impacts that would damage standard products, crucial during June-August thunderstorms and September-October nor'easters. Proper installation includes high-wind nailing patterns, sealed decking, and reinforced flashing at vulnerable intersections. This approach prevents wind uplift and water intrusion that cause most storm-related insurance claims.

Could my attic mold problem be related to roof ventilation?
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ates moisture accumulation that leads to attic mold and decking rot. The 2021 IRC with Massachusetts amendments requires specific intake and exhaust ratios based on attic square footage. Balanced airflow prevents warm, moist air from condensing on cold decking surfaces during temperature swings. Proper ventilation extends shingle life by reducing thermal cycling stress and prevents ice dam formation in winter months.
